Default Key Fob/Lock Issue

Don't know if this has been dicussed elsewhere. Couldn't find anything after a quick search.

2006 RX330...yesterday when locking the car the 'beep' wouldn't sound and the front doors wouldn't lock. I could hear the back doors lock. I could only lock the car manually with the key. However, if you hit the unlock, all would open and the beep sounded and the lights flashed.

I removed and replaced the fob battery (it was probably original) and that cured it for a day. This morning, same exact problem as yesterday - no lock in the front, no beep when locking, back doors lock. The unlock works fine.

Any ideas?

Update:
This apparently affects only the drivers side door lock...all other lock appear to function correctly, with the exception of the beep and light flash. May be an intermittent problem. Wondering if it is the actuator, but the locks works fine with the manual switch and key in the door.

I will try using the other key fob to see if the fob itself is the problem. Don't really want to have to replace that!

Another Update:
I finally got around to getting the replacement actuator from Rock Auto. Despite it being identified on the website as a Dorman product, it is made by AISIN. The OEM is AISIN. Once I figured out there were 2 connections inside the door (handle rod and key lock) behind the actuator (this was all by touch), then things worked a little better. Broke some tabs on the trim for the window garnish triangle so I will be spending a couple of dollars to replace that, but overall I figured I saved $$$ on this DIY repair.
